探索Telegram飞机源码配置的详细步骤和最佳实践,本文深入剖析了如何高效配置Telegram源码,涵盖从基础环境搭建到高级功能实现的全方位指南。结合亿录团队在海外源码领域的专业经验,提供最新案例数据和权威资源引用,助力开发者快速掌握Telegram源码配置的核心技巧。
引言:Telegram飞机源码配置的重要性
Telegram作为全球知名的即时通讯工具,其开源特性吸引了大量开发者。掌握Telegram飞机源码配置,不仅能够提升应用性能,还能实现个性化功能定制。本文将详细介绍Telegram飞机源码配置的全流程,帮助开发者高效搭建和优化Telegram应用。
基础环境搭建:从零开始配置Telegram源码
首先,确保系统环境满足基本要求。推荐使用Linux或macOS系统,安装最新版本的Python(建议使用Python 3.8以上版本)。通过以下命令安装必要的依赖包:
bash
sudo apt-get update
sudo apt-get install python3-pip
pip3 install virtualenv
创建虚拟环境并激活:
bash
virtualenv venv
source venv/bin/activate
这一步骤为后续源码配置提供了稳定的基础环境。
获取Telegram源码:官方仓库与第三方资源
Telegram官方提供了完整的源码仓库,可通过GitHub获取。使用Git命令克隆官方仓库:
bash
git clone https://github.com/telegramdesktop/tdesktop.git
cd tdesktop
此外,一些第三方资源如Telegram-FOSS也提供了优化后的源码版本,可根据需求选择。亿录团队建议优先使用官方源码,确保稳定性和安全性。
编译Telegram源码:常见问题与解决方案
编译是源码配置的关键步骤。在Linux环境下,使用以下命令进行编译:
bash
./build.sh
编译过程中可能遇到依赖问题,如缺少Qt库等。可通过以下命令安装缺失的依赖:
bash
sudo apt-get install qtbase5-dev qttools5-dev-tools
亿录团队建议在编译前详细阅读官方文档,确保所有依赖项齐全。
配置文件详解:优化Telegram性能
Telegram的配置文件(如`config.json`)决定了应用的各项参数。关键配置项包括:
– `api_id`和`api_hash`:从Telegram官方获取,用于认证。
– `database_directory`:数据存储路径。
– `files_directory`:文件存储路径。
通过合理配置这些参数,可以有效提升应用性能和数据安全性。
高级功能实现:自定义插件与API集成
Telegram源码支持自定义插件和API集成,实现更多个性化功能。例如,通过集成第三方API,可以实现自动回复、数据分析等功能。亿录团队推荐使用Python编写插件,利用`telethon`库进行API调用:
python
from telethon import TelegramClient
api_id = ‘YOUR_API_ID’
api_hash = ‘YOUR_API_HASH’
client = TelegramClient(‘session_name’, api_id, api_hash)
async def main():
await client.send_message(‘username’, ‘Hello, Telegram!’)
with client:
client.loop.run_until_complete(main())
通过这种方式,开发者可以灵活扩展Telegram的功能。
安全性与隐私保护:配置最佳实践
在配置Telegram源码时,安全性与隐私保护至关重要。建议采取以下措施:
– 使用强密码和多因素认证。
– 定期更新源码和依赖包,修复安全漏洞。
– 对敏感数据进行加密存储。
亿录团队强调,安全配置是保障用户信任的基础。
案例分析:成功应用Telegram源码的项目
以亿录团队参与的一个海外项目为例,该项目通过定制Telegram源码,实现了企业内部通讯的全面优化。项目关键数据如下:
– 用户数:5000+
– 消息传输延迟:平均50ms
– 数据安全性:采用AES-256加密
该项目成功展示了Telegram源码在大型企业应用中的高效性和可靠性。
未来趋势:Telegram源码配置的发展方向
随着技术的不断进步,Telegram源码配置将迎来更多创新。未来趋势包括:
– 更高效的编译工具和优化算法。
– 支持更多编程语言和平台的插件开发。
– 强化人工智能和大数据分析功能。
亿录团队将持续关注并引领这些技术趋势,为开发者提供最新的解决方案。
结语:掌握Telegram飞机源码配置,提升开发实力
通过本文的详细讲解,开发者可以全面掌握Telegram飞机源码配置的各个环节。结合亿录团队

评论(0)